Dans les deux cas on attaque une table Modbus (ensemble de mots de 16bits) formée de la façon suivante :
Pour un ARF50 on a un block d'information de 16 mots de 16 bits :
Indice du mot
Label du mot
0
DI
1
AI1
2
AI2
3
CPT1
4
CPT2
5
CPT3
6
CPT4
7
DO
8
AO1
9
AO2
A
enable
B
ComErrorImage valeur sur 8 bits (0 à 255)
C
ComErrorCpt
D
NS1
E
NS2
F
NS3
208009A-V1.3-UG_ARF50
Signification des 16 bits du mot
Bits : [0-0-0-0-0-0-0-0—0-0-0-0-DI4-
DI3-DI2-DI1]
Valeur sur 12 bits (0 .. 4095) de l'en-
trée analogique 1
Valeur sur 12 bits (0 .. 4095) de l'en-
trée analogique 2
Valeur sur 16 bits (0 .. 65535) du
compteur sur DI1
Valeur sur 16 bits (0 .. 65535) du
compteur sur DI2
Valeur sur 16 bits (0 .. 65535) du
compteur sur DI3
Valeur sur 16 bits (0 .. 65535) du
compteur sur DI4
Bits : [0-0-0-0-0-0-0-0—0-0-0-0-DO4-
DO3-DO2-DO1]
Valeur sur 12 bits (0 .. 4095) de la
sortie analogique 1
Valeur sur 12 bits (0 .. 4095) de la
sortie analogique 2
0 : Disable , 1 : enable
valeur sur 16 bits (0 à 65535)
[L] [AA]
[SS] [N]
[XXXX]
Commentaires
Représentation des 4 entrées digi-
tales
Lecture de l'entrée analogique N°1
Lecture de l'entrée analogique N°2
Lecture du compteur de l'entrée
digitale N°1
Lecture du compteur de l'entrée
digitale N°2
Lecture du compteur de l'entrée
digitale N°3
Lecture du compteur de l'entrée
digitale N°4
Représentation des 4 sorties digi-
tales
Lecture de la sortie analogique N°1
Lecture de la sortie analogique N°2
Indique si l'ARF50 est actif
incrémentation à chaque erreur,
décrémentation à chaque réussite
incrémentation à chaque erreur de-
puis la mise sous tension
[ L lettre ou chiffre en ASCII] [AA
nombre (année de fabrication) sur
8 bits (de 0 à 255)]
[N lettre ou chiffre en ASCII] [SS
nombre (semaine de fabrication)
sur 8 bits (de 0 à 255)]
[XXXX nombre sur 16 bits (de 0 à
65535)]
23